System overview
Overview
Sepax C-Pro processes cellular product and directs it into dedicated kit bags, at the
end of the procedure.
The instrument core technology includes the following features:
• An electric centrifugation motor to concentrate, separate, and wash cellular
product via the separation chamber of the single-use kit.
• A pneumatic circuitry to drive the separation chamber piston in order to fill and
extract the content of the separation chamber.
• A pressure sensor and an optical sensor to monitor the procedure.
Additional features are:
• Rotary pins to align the position of the stopcocks on the single-use kit.
• Windows Operating System embedded and proprietary GMAP software.
• Four USB ports and two Ethernet ports to provide connectivity and traceability.
• User interface with touchscreen.
